Rev3 Sensor Revision

Framos GmbH is distributing a line of USB 3.0 cameras from Lumenera equipped with rev3, a sensor revision that provides increased analog gain and elimination of the “black sun effect.”

Based on the second revision of CMOSIS sensors CMV2000 (Lt225 model) and CMV4000 (Lt425), the 2- and 4-MP color and monochrome cameras capture images at up to 180 fps. They feature 5.5-μm pixel size, a blur-free global shutter CMOS sensor, low noise and high sensitivity. The near-IR variants offer very high sensitivity, suitable for astronomy applications.

The cameras measure 40 × 40 × 60 mm, with 16 mounting points.
